Solvation-Anionic Exchange Mechanism of Solvent Extraction: Enhanced U(VI) Uptake by Tetradentate Phenanthroline Ligands

Svetlana V. Gutorova et al.

Summary: Phenanthroline diamides (L) have the unique ability to extract uranium from nitric acid solutions and form 1:2 stoichiometry complexes as tight ion pairs {[UO2LNO3]+[UO2(NO3)3]-} in a polar organic solvent. This extraction mechanism combines solvation and ion-pair anion exchange, and was confirmed by UV-vis study and chemical synthesis. The structure of the complexes in the solid state was unambiguously determined through chemical synthesis and single crystal growth.

Organophosphorus Extractants: A Critical Choice for Actinides/Lanthanides Separation in Nuclear Fuel Cycle

Xiaofan Yang et al.

Summary: The separation of actinides from lanthanides is a crucial step in the spent nuclear fuel reprocessing. Organophosphorus extractants, such as tributyl phosphate (TBP) and octyl(phenyl)-N,N-diisobutylcarbamoylmethylphosphine oxide (CMPO), have been widely used due to their strong extraction ability and low cost. This article discusses the application scope, extraction mechanism, structure-function relationships, and newly developed organophosphorus extractants for the separation of actinides over lanthanides. The important role of these extractants and their potential applications in future advanced nuclear fuel cycle are also emphasized.

Pyrrolidine-Derived Phenanthroline Diamides: An Influence of Fluorine Atoms on the Coordination of Lu(III) and Some Other f-Elements and Their Solvent Extraction

Nane A. Avagyan et al.

Summary: Three pyrrolidine-derived phenanthroline diamides were studied as ligands for lutetium trinitrate. The presence of halogen atoms in the structure of phenanthroline ligands has a significant impact on the coordination number of lutetium and the number of solvate water molecules. Fluorinated ligands showed higher efficiency based on the measured stability constants. Complexation with lutetium led to a shift in the F-19 NMR signal. The advantages of chlorinated and fluorinated pyrrolidine diamides in liquid-liquid extraction were demonstrated.

First Example of Fluorinated Phenanthroline Diamides: Synthesis, Structural Study, and Complexation with Lanthanoids

Nane A. Avagyan et al.

Summary: An efficient method for synthesizing diamides of 4,7-difluoro-1,10-phenanthroline-2,9-dicarboxylic acid was elaborated. The method involves direct nucleophilic substitution with 4,7-dichloro-1,10-phenanthroline precursors, resulting in high yields of difluoro derivatives. Four new fluorinated ligands were successfully prepared and their structures were confirmed using spectroscopic methods and X-ray data. Lanthanoid complexes were also synthesized to demonstrate the applicability of the new ligands, with their structures studied using solid-state (IR spectroscopy, X-ray diffraction) and solution-state (NMR spectroscopy) techniques.

2-Methylpyrrolidine derived 1,10-phenanthroline-2,9-diamides: promising extractants for Am(iii)/Ln(iii) separation

P. S. Lemport et al.

Summary: In this study, new examples of phenanthrolindiamides with asymmetric centers in amide substituents were synthesized and their structures were confirmed by spectral analysis and X-ray analysis. The synthesized ligands were found to form complexes with nitrates of rare-earth elements, and the stability constants of these complexes in acetonitrile solution were measured. Solvent extraction experiments showed that the presence of methyl groups in cyclic amide substituents significantly affected the distribution ratios and selectivity factors in the lanthanides(iii) and Am(iii) series.

Highly efficient actinide(III)/lanthanide(III) separation by novel pillar[5] arene-based picolinamide ligands: A study on synthesis, solvent extraction and complexation

Yimin Cai et al.

Summary: The study introduces five novel pillar[5]arene-based extractants that efficiently separate actinides(III) from lanthanides(III). These ligands exhibit high extraction selectivity for Am(III) over Eu(III) at around pH 3.0, with no significant decrease in performance after exposure to gamma radiation.
